About Complocated


In Short
Complocated was set up in the summer of 2007, and since it's launch has strived to deliver the public with the high-quality and most-accurate electronic reviews out there. Complocated is extremely different to a lot of its rival sites as it's offers an environment completely free of "best-prices". Furthermore, we do not sell any items at Complocated, making us a completely impartial source. This allows you our audience and viewers, to read, write and respond to reviews, secure in the knowledge that your reviews, providing they are free of bad language and poor grammar, will be shown to the world. We have absolutely no incentive to deny any of your views on a product, which again contrasts with reviews from e-Commerce websites - displaying review upon review of "1 Star" will only hinder their sales and cause them to maintain stock, and therefore loose money. We want to put your views to the rest of the world.
